The planning portal stipulates that a loft conversion must be set back 20cm min from the eaves, but does not say from what part of the eaves to which part of the extension the dimension is measured. Is there any guidelines for this?

The measurement of 20cm should be made along the original roof slope from the
outermost edge of the eaves (the edge of the tiles or slates) to the edge of the
enlargement. Any guttering that protrudes beyond the roof slope should not be
included in this measurement.
